奥礼网
新记
如何对一些数据排序后,获得某一条数据在总数里面的排名,数据库查询语句如何写呢,能给个例子更好,
用 hql 语句如何查询某条数据在排序后的行数(排名)?sql语句能运行,但是hql不行
举报该文章
其他看法
第1个回答 2013-07-11
select t.*,rownum from (select * from tablename order by id) t
追问
用hql语句怎么写呢
本回答被网友采纳
第2个回答 2016-08-17
$info->query('select * FROM (SELECT * FROM b_info ORDER BY istop=1 DESC)b_info ORDER BY istop=1 DESC')
第3个回答 2013-07-11
这个问题新鲜,一同等待!
相似回答
大家正在搜
相关问题
汇总计算再排序的sql查询语句如何写
求一个sql查询语句,一条记录,要显示它在众多记录中,按时间...
如何用一条SQL语句查询某人所在名次,注意,是名次。 mys...
从oracle数据库查询出的数据,按其中一个字段时间排序。查...
在MYSQL中怎么写SQL语句,能取到表中按ID降序排列的前...
postgresql某数据表中有多天的记录存在,我想取某天的...
thinkphp如何查询某一条数据在所有查询到的数据中的排名...